Official reason

Iran Chassis Manufacturing Co., another wholly owned subsidiary of Bahman Group, has purchased tens of millions of dollars’ worth of goods from Esfahan’s Mobarakeh Steel Company, Iran’s largest steel producer. Mobarakeh Steel Company is used as a revenue stream for Bonyad Taavon Basij’s economic conglomerate. Mobarakeh Steel Company was designated pursuant to E.O. 13224 on October 16, 2018 for assisting, sponsoring, or providing financial, material, or technological support for, or financial or other services to or in support of, Mehr Eqtesad Iranian Investment Company, an entity with close ties to the Basij Resistance Force and its Bonyad Taavon Basij. The Basij was concurrently designated pursuant to E.O. 13224 for being owned or controlled by the IRGC and for assisting, sponsoring, or providing financial, material, or technological support for, or financial or other services to or in support of, the IRGC-QF. Iran Chassis Manufacturing Co. is being designated pursuant to E.O. 13224, as amended, for having materially assisted, sponsored, or provided financial, material, or technological support for, or good or services to or in support of, Mobarakeh Steel Company. Bahman Group is being designated pursuant to E.O. 13224, as amended, for owning or controlling, directly or indirectly, Bahman Diesel Co., Iran Docharkh Co., and Iran Chassis Manufacturing Co. Bahman Group is being concurrently delisted for having materially assisted, sponsored, or provided financial, material, or technological support for, or goods or services to or in support of, the IRGC.

Official Information

On August 16, 2010, OFAC issued the Iranian Financial Sanctions Regulations, 31 CFR part 561 (75 FR 49836, August 16, 2010) (IFSR) to implement provisions of the Comprehensive Iran Sanctions, Accountability, and Divestment Act of 2010 (Pub. L. 111–195) (22 U.S.C. 8501–8551). Since then, OFAC has amended the IFSR several times.
